Odisha Cricket Association (OCA) in Cuttack
The Odisha Cricket Association (OCA) in Cuttack City is at the centre of controversy amid allegations of favouritism in its selection process. Senior player Suryakant Pradhan came forward on Thursday with serious accusations, stating that the selection committee tends to favour familiar faces over seasoned players.
Pradhan claims that, despite demonstrating talent and performance, certain deserving cricketers are being overlooked in favour of those who have personal connections with committee members. He specifically alleged that the chairman of the selection committee is prioritising players from his own club for positions in the Odisha team.
In light of these accusations, Pradhan has urged the OCA secretary to examine these issues minutely. In response, Sujit Biswal, a member of the selection committee, replied to address these claims of senior cricketer Surya Pradhan.
“Why my name was not included? Those who have not scored any runs, how they get enlisted? Their names were added later because they belong to the selection committee chairman’s club,” Surya Pradhan alleged.
“Lobby is going on for selection. Recently, my team became champion in a T-20 tournament. Still, my name is not there in the selection list,” the senior cricketer rued.
Reacting to this, Sujit Biswal stated, “I would say that Surya Pradhan is a good player and has contributed a lot for Odisha. He claims that he had played well in Odisha Premier League (OPL) held in June-July. However, he was recently given another opportunity to play for the Ranji Trophy, in which he had taken only seven wickets in six innings and scored a total of only 36 runs.”
“Suryakant could not stand up to the expectations and could not match the stature that he had. His performance deteriorated day by day. A person is selected to a team based on current performance. It is not that we have entirely dropped him,” Sujit Biswal added.
